At its heart, blockchain is a distributed database, a continuously growing list of records, called blocks, which are linked and secured using cryptography. Each block contains a cryptographic hash of the previous block, a timestamp, and transaction data. This interconnected chain makes it incredibly difficult to alter any information once it’s been recorded. Think of it like a digital notary, but one that’s shared and verified by an entire network, not just a single entity. This inherent transparency and immutability are the cornerstones of its revolutionary potential. Instead of relying on central authorities – banks, governments, or corporations – to validate and secure transactions, blockchain distributes this power across a network of participants. This decentralization is not merely a technical detail; it’s a philosophical shift that democratizes control and fosters a new level of trust.

The implications of this decentralized trust model are far-reaching. In the realm of finance, blockchain is already disrupting traditional banking and payment systems. Cryptocurrencies, the most visible manifestation of blockchain, offer faster, cheaper, and more accessible cross-border transactions, bypassing intermediaries that often add layers of cost and delay. But the impact extends beyond just currency. Smart contracts, self-executing contracts with the terms of the agreement directly written into code, are automating processes that once required extensive legal frameworks and manual oversight. Imagine a property sale where ownership is automatically transferred once payment is confirmed, or an insurance policy that pays out automatically when predefined conditions are met. These are not futuristic fantasies; they are functionalities being developed and deployed today, streamlining operations and reducing the potential for fraud and error.

The supply chain industry, notoriously complex and opaque, is another fertile ground for blockchain innovation. Tracking goods from origin to consumer has historically been a challenge, rife with opportunities for counterfeiting, theft, and inefficiencies. By creating an immutable record of every step a product takes, blockchain provides unprecedented visibility and traceability. A consumer could scan a QR code on a product and instantly verify its authenticity, its origin, and even the ethical sourcing of its components. This not only builds consumer confidence but also empowers businesses to identify bottlenecks, optimize logistics, and ensure compliance with regulations. From luxury goods to pharmaceuticals, the ability to guarantee provenance and authenticity is a game-changer.

Healthcare is also beginning to harness the power of blockchain. Patient data, often fragmented and siloed across different providers, could be securely stored and managed on a blockchain. Patients could grant specific access permissions to doctors, researchers, or insurers, maintaining control over their sensitive medical information while facilitating better coordinated care and accelerating medical research. The immutability of the blockchain ensures the integrity of medical records, crucial for accurate diagnoses and treatments. Furthermore, it can streamline the complex process of drug tracking, preventing counterfeit medications from entering the supply chain and ensuring the efficacy of treatments.

The advent of Non-Fungible Tokens (NFTs) has brought a new wave of public awareness to blockchain's capabilities, particularly in the creative industries. NFTs are unique digital assets that represent ownership of a specific item, whether it's a piece of digital art, a virtual collectible, or even a tweet. By leveraging blockchain, NFTs provide verifiable proof of ownership and scarcity for digital content, empowering artists and creators to monetize their work in new ways and directly connect with their audience. This has sparked a revolution in digital art, music, and collectibles, opening up new avenues for artistic expression and economic empowerment. The ability to own and trade unique digital assets is a fundamental shift in how we perceive and value digital goods.

Beyond these immediate applications, blockchain is laying the groundwork for the next iteration of the internet – Web3, often referred to as the decentralized web. In this vision, users will have greater control over their data and online identities, moving away from the centralized platforms that currently dominate the digital landscape. Decentralized autonomous organizations (DAOs) are emerging as a new model for governance and collaboration, allowing communities to make decisions collectively without central leadership. The metaverse, a persistent, shared virtual space, is also being built on blockchain infrastructure, promising immersive experiences where ownership of digital assets and the ability to participate in virtual economies are paramount. Consider the implications for digital identity. In our current online world, managing multiple logins and struggling with data privacy is a constant battle. Blockchain offers the potential for self-sovereign identity, where individuals control their digital credentials. Imagine a single, secure digital wallet that holds verified attestations about who you are – your age, your educational qualifications, your professional certifications – all managed by you. You could then selectively share this information with trusted entities, without relinquishing control or exposing unnecessary personal data. This not only enhances privacy and security but also simplifies online interactions and reduces the risk of identity theft. This shift from platform-controlled identities to user-controlled identities is a profound change, placing power back into the hands of individuals.

The energy sector, often perceived as a slow adopter of new technologies, is also seeing blockchain’s potential to foster transparency and efficiency. Peer-to-peer energy trading, for instance, could become a reality, allowing individuals with solar panels to sell surplus energy directly to their neighbors, facilitated by smart contracts that automate billing and settlement. This not only promotes renewable energy adoption but also decentralizes power generation and distribution, creating more resilient and efficient energy grids. The ability to track the origin and flow of energy can also enhance accountability and transparency in complex energy markets, combating fraud and ensuring fair pricing.

In the realm of intellectual property and copyright, blockchain offers a powerful solution for creators. The current system for protecting and enforcing intellectual property rights can be cumbersome and expensive. With blockchain, creators can timestamp and register their work, creating an immutable record of ownership. This can simplify the process of proving authorship, licensing content, and even tracking its usage across various platforms. For musicians, writers, and artists, this means a more direct and secure way to manage their creative output and ensure they are fairly compensated for their work. NFTs have already demonstrated a fraction of this potential, but the broader applications for copyright management are vast and largely untapped.

The impact on governance and public services is another area ripe for transformation. Blockchain’s inherent transparency and immutability make it an ideal candidate for secure and verifiable voting systems, potentially mitigating concerns about election integrity. Public records, such as land registries and business licenses, could be managed on a blockchain, reducing corruption and increasing efficiency. Imagine a government where land ownership is transparently recorded and easily verifiable, making property disputes far less common and significantly reducing the potential for fraudulent land grabs. This has profound implications for economic development and social stability in many parts of the world.

The democratization of finance, often referred to as DeFi (Decentralized Finance), is perhaps one of the most rapidly evolving areas of blockchain application.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– on decentralized platforms, removing the need for intermediaries like banks. This offers greater accessibility, lower fees, and more innovative financial products, especially for individuals in underserved regions who lack access to traditional banking services. While still in its nascent stages and presenting its own set of risks, DeFi represents a powerful vision for a more inclusive and efficient global financial system. The ability for anyone with an internet connection to participate in sophisticated financial markets is a revolutionary concept.

Equity vs Token Fundraising: The Fundamentals

When it comes to securing the lifeblood of innovation—capital—two primary avenues often come to mind: equity fundraising and token fundraising. While both aim to fuel growth and development, they operate on fundamentally different principles.

Equity Fundraising: A Time-Tested Approach

Equity fundraising, the traditional method, involves selling shares of the company to investors in exchange for capital. This method has been a cornerstone of venture capital for decades, providing a structured way for startups to attract funding from seasoned investors.

Pros:

Proven Track Record: Equity fundraising is a well-established method that has been successfully used by many iconic companies to grow and scale. Its track record provides a level of comfort and predictability that many investors prefer. Strong Backing from Institutional Investors: Equity fundraising often attracts institutional investors, such as venture capital firms, private equity funds, and hedge funds, who bring not just capital but also valuable expertise and networks. Clear Valuation: Equity rounds typically come with a clear valuation of the company, which helps in understanding the financial health and growth potential of the startup.

Cons:

Dilution of Ownership: For founders and existing shareholders, equity fundraising often means diluting ownership, which can be a tough pill to swallow. The more shares sold, the smaller the ownership stake. Complexity: The process can be complex and time-consuming, involving detailed due diligence, legal agreements, and often prolonged negotiations. Potential for Misalignment: There is a risk of misalignment between investors and founders if the vision, goals, and management styles do not align.

Token Fundraising: The New Frontier

In contrast, token fundraising leverages blockchain technology to offer a new way of raising capital. Through Initial Coin Offerings (ICOs), Initial Exchange Offerings (IEOs), and other token sale mechanisms, startups can issue tokens that represent equity or utility rights.

Pros:

Global Access: Token fundraising can attract a global pool of investors, democratizing investment opportunities and allowing startups to tap into a broader market. Transparency: Blockchain technology offers high levels of transparency and security, which can build trust and reduce fraud risks. Faster Process: Token sales can often be completed more quickly than traditional equity fundraising, as they rely on smart contracts and automated processes. Utility Tokens: Utility tokens can provide real value to users, incentivizing them to adopt the product or service, which can lead to increased user engagement and network effects.

Cons:

Regulatory Uncertainty: The regulatory landscape for token fundraising is still evolving, which can create uncertainty and risk for both startups and investors. Technological Risks: Tokens are tied to blockchain technology, which is still relatively new and carries inherent risks, including security vulnerabilities and technological failures. Market Volatility: The cryptocurrency market is notoriously volatile, which can pose significant risks for investors and complicate the valuation of tokens. Complexity of Blockchain: Understanding blockchain technology and how it applies to token fundraising can be complex, requiring a steep learning curve for many participants.

Strategic Implications and Future Trends in Equity vs Token Fundraising

Having covered the fundamentals of equity and token fundraising, it’s time to delve into their strategic implications and future trends. This exploration will help you understand how these methods might evolve and shape the landscape of venture capital.

Strategic Implications:

For Startups:

Equity Fundraising: Ideal for startups with a clear, scalable business model and a strong track record of growth. It provides the capital needed to expand operations, hire talent, and invest in R&D.

Token Fundraising: Suitable for tech-driven startups, particularly those in the blockchain space, looking to rapidly scale their user base and integrate innovative technologies into their offerings.

For Investors:

Equity Investors: Prefer startups with a proven business model and a clear path to profitability. They often invest in exchange for equity and may seek board representation and significant influence over company decisions.

Crypto Investors: Typically attracted to the potential for high returns and the ability to participate in the early stages of a project. They may invest in tokens with an understanding of the associated risks and regulatory uncertainties.

For Ecosystems:

Traditional VC Ecosystems: May face disruption as token fundraising democratizes access to capital. However, they can also benefit from integrating blockchain technology to enhance their offerings.

Blockchain Ecosystems: Stand to gain from the influx of global investors and the innovative potential of token-based funding mechanisms.

Future Trends:

Hybrid Models:

The future may see hybrid models that combine the best of both worlds. For example, a startup might use token fundraising to quickly raise initial capital and then transition to equity fundraising for further growth. This dual approach can offer the flexibility and speed of token fundraising while leveraging the credibility and resources of traditional equity investors.

Regulatory Clarity:

As regulatory frameworks evolve, we can expect clearer guidelines for token fundraising, reducing uncertainty and attracting more institutional investors. Governments and regulatory bodies are increasingly recognizing the potential of blockchain technology and are working to create a balanced regulatory environment.

Integration of Tokenomics:

Tokenomics—the study of token-based economics—will play a crucial role in determining the success of token fundraising. Well-designed tokenomics can incentivize users, ensure fair distribution, and create sustainable value over time. Startups will need to focus on creating robust tokenomics models to attract and retain investors.

Decentralized Governance:

Token fundraising often comes with the promise of decentralized governance, where token holders have a say in the company’s decisions. This can democratize decision-making but also requires careful structuring to avoid conflicts and ensure efficient governance.

Sustainability and ESG:

Environmental, Social, and Governance (ESG) factors will increasingly influence both equity and token fundraising. Startups focusing on sustainable practices and ethical governance will likely attract more investors, regardless of the funding method.
